It is the principle of the thing. If you allow government to tell you what you can or cannot do to yourself in one area, they will encroach into another. It is the nature of govt to expand, the nose under the tent principle.

Don't you get tired of the constant battle on so many political fronts? Of course you do. The reason, government must be constantly monitored, checked against basic principles, and guarded against their intrusion. You simply cannot allow them to tell you what you can or cannot do to yourself, or they will begin to take that "right" and stretch it to the point we are at now.

Tobacco, alcohol, salt, fatty foods, hydrogenated oil, coconut oil, pepper. All things that the govt has no business disallowing people to ingest, but they do. The only way to get them out of this intrusive mindset, is with the principle, "I OWN ME".

It is not my fault that society taxes others to pay for my bad choices. It is societies fault for intruding into that area that is my responsibility. It is my friends and relatives that can be emotionally hurt by my choices. So what?, government should not be in the business of protecting people from emotional hurt. If government uses "hurt" to family as a reason to control ME, what is the end game? Why cannot they disallow homosexuality, because it hurts family and friends? How about outlawing pre-marital sex? Pregnancy without insurance? Pregnancy outside of marriage? Too many children for government to handle? We must draw a line between govt and ourself, and the place to draw it is a principled on. I OWN ME, butt out and leave me alone.

Now, when I'm really cookin' probably 60 to 80. Sometimes I actually get slowed down by the keyboard.

I use the dvorak keyboard layout. The standard Qwerty keyboard (named for the top row of keys) was allegedly made the standard layout because the original kingpin who monopolized typewriter manufacturing had this layout. The layout was supposedly chosen because his sales guys, who of course couldn't type, could give a reasonably impressive and quick demo by typing "typewriter" --- because all the letters required to type it are on the top row. In fact the layout might have been designed to slow typists down because typing too fast on those mechanical machines could cause them to jam -- something obviously not much of a concern on computer keyboards.

Mr. Dvorak invented a new layout which puts the most commonly used keys, like vowels on the left hand home keys, and the most common consonants on the right side home keys. Second most used are on the top row and least used on the bottom row. They are strategically positioned so you most often switch between left and right hand with each letter when typing which also increases speed.

Takes getting used to, but I've been using dvorak for about the last 14 years or so. The motor skills are the same so the switch is purely in your brain. Both windows and linux allow the option. I occasionally gotta do qwerty when on other computers but part of my brain remembers it. Gotta watch the keyboard then but can still type okay.
